The Certificate in Space Regulation for the Space Industry is a comprehensive course designed to meet the growing demand for legal and regulatory expertise in the space sector. This program equips learners with critical skills needed to navigate the complex legal landscape of the space industry, including understanding of national and international space laws, regulatory compliance, risk management, and policy analysis.

CourseDetails

โ€ข Space Law and Regulation Overview
โ€ข International Space Law
โ€ข National Space Laws and Policies
โ€ข Space Debris Management and Regulation
โ€ข Space Exploration and Scientific Research Regulation
โ€ข Space Commerce and Business Regulation
โ€ข Legal Aspects of Satellite Communications and Remote Sensing
โ€ข Space Mining and Resource Utilization Regulation
โ€ข Space Tourism Regulation
โ€ข Space Insurance and Liability Regulation

The space industry is rapidly growing, creating numerous job opportunities for professionals with relevant skills and knowledge. This 3D pie chart represents the UK space job market trends, focusing on roles related to space regulation, policy-making, and engineering. The chart highlights the percentage of professionals employed in various roles, including Space Policy Analyst, Space Lawyer, Space Compliance Officer, Satellite Communications Engineer, Space Operations Manager, and Space Project Coordinator. Space Policy Analysts (25%) play a crucial role in shaping the future of the space sector by researching, analyzing, and developing policies. Their expertise in space law, technology, and international relations contributes to a thriving space industry. As the demand for legal professionals in the space sector increases, Space Lawyers (20%) are becoming increasingly important. They specialize in space law, helping companies navigate complex regulations and ensuring compliance with national and international laws. Space Compliance Officers (15%) ensure that space organizations follow industry standards and regulations, reducing risks and maintaining a positive public image. Satellite Communications Engineers (20%) design, build, and maintain satellite communication systems, enabling global connectivity and supporting various applications, such as weather forecasting and navigation. Space Operations Managers (10%) oversee daily operations, ensuring seamless project execution and efficient resource allocation. Space Project Coordinators (10%) manage cross-functional teams, coordinate resources, and facilitate communication among stakeholders to successfully deliver space projects.
